10 Best Bars in Rome

beer bars in Rome

While there’s plenty of information around about good places to eat in Rome, it can sometimes be tricky to locate the right bar for an afternoon drink, pre-dinner glass of wine, or a late-night cocktail. Never fear! We’ve rounded up some of the best cafes, bars, and pubs in the Eternal City to ease the transition from day into evening. All of the places listed are in the historical center or located near metro stations. Cheers!

1. Barnum Café

Via del Pellegrino 87, Tel +39 0664760483

Part coffee shop, part wine bar, Barnum really comes alive at night when its talented bar-staff mix some of the best cocktails in town. In pleasant, shabby-chic surroundings not far from the crowds of Campo de’ Fiori, cosy armchairs, fresh breakfasts, gourmet sandwiches, burgers, aperitifs and occasional DJ sets make it good to go day or night. Free wifi just adds to the experience. (coffee, wine, cocktails)

2. Club Derriere

Vicolo delle Coppelle 59, tel +39 0645502826

Accessed through a white wardrobe at the back of a restaurant called Osteria delle Coppelle, Club Derriere is one of Rome’s trendiest new drinking dens. Deliberately hidden from view, this windowless speakeasy is part Scottish castle, part wartime bunker, with leather sofas, worn carpets, and suits of armor. Open from 9.30 pm until late, order a classic cocktail here or home-brewed spirits and enjoy the live music on Friday and Saturday nights. There’s also an anonymous street entrance in Vicolo delle Coppelle, where you have to ring the bell. (cocktails, digestifs)

3. Porto Fluviale

Via del Porto Fluviale 22, Tel +39 065743199

Dressed with hurricane lamps, white wood, and gleaming ceramic tiles, this all-day bar and trattoria is a big fish in an up-and-coming area awash with restaurants inspired by Rome’s nautical past. While Porto Fluviale is ideal for a fragrant pastry and coffee for breakfast, a lazy brunch, or lunch, it really comes into its own after 6 o’clock when locals pop in for an aperitivo. Try an Aperol or Campari based cocktail, a glass of wine from the daily-changing list, or sup on Porto Fluviale’s in-house ales – a crisp lager, floral Weiss beer, or a very hoppy IPA – rigorously accompanied with mouthwatering snacks and taster sized portions from Porto Fluviale’s kitchens, including creamy risottos and tangy pasta dishes, as well as fat black olives and hand-cooked chips. (coffee, tea, wine, craft beer, cocktails)


4. Luppolo 12 (low-key)

Via dei Marrucini 12, Tel +39 066838989

This buzzing craft beer pub is adored by Rome’s students and it’s easy to see why. Located in the university district of San Lorenzo, not far from Termini station, it’s a simple enough spot with a premium tap list of Italian and international beers. With happy hour prices until 9 every evening and all night on Tuesdays, grab a table and enjoy the freshly prepared bar snacks with your drinks, including cold cuts and sandwiches. (coffee, craft beer)

5. Apt

Via Clementina 9, Tel +39 338 942 8143

Apt is the latest Roman cocktail bar in 1930s style, although it’s not a speakeasy, making a pleasant change. Located in trendy Monti, while this an underground hang-out, it has a spacious, airy vibe due to its high ceilings and well-placed vintage sofas and chairs. Here, the bar staff and DJs – all very smart in 1930s gear – seem to be enjoying themselves as much as the hip clientele. Expect new and old-world cocktails served in vintage glassware, light bites, and a music set featuring electro-swing and Big Band tunes. (coffee, wine, craft beer, cocktails)

6. Chakra cafe (cocktails)

Piazza S. Rufina 13, Tel +39 3382917593

In eclectic, warm surroundings, this is the perfect place to escape the hustle and bustle of Trastevere for a glass of wine or beer, a hot chocolate, or a cocktail prepared by the knowledgeable and friendly staff. Occasional live music nights or a big game on discreet screens add to the cozy atmosphere, while in spring and summer, expect to sit outside in the pretty lane, using a beer barrel as a table and watching the world saunter by. (coffee, tea, wine, beer, cocktails)

7. Apartment bar (cocktail bar)

Via dei Marrucini 1, Tel +39 0693576164

This wine and cocktail bar 10 minutes from Termini station offers a great selection of drinks, with DJs thrown in at weekends. Come early for an aperitivo, served with cold snacks, or join the young crowds after dinner for long drinks and cocktails. Sit at high tables in the shabby-chic ground floor bar or recline on its rooftop Paradise Garden amongst tropical plants in the heart of the trendy San Lorenzo district. (craft beer, wine, cocktails)

8. Open Baladin

Via degli Specchi 6, Tel 0039 066838989

This buzzing craft beer pub is hugely popular with young people enamored by its tap list and excellent bar food, featuring burgers, hand-cooked chips, and gourmet ketchup. With guest beers on rotation from all over Europe and the United States, as well as a huge menu of regular favorites, ask the friendly staff for their tips, or flick through the weekly menu. Lookout as well for special tasting events, led by local brewers. (craft beer)

9. Coffee Pot Trastevere

Via del Politeama 12, coffeepot-roma.com

The latest cool address in Trastevere is Coffee Pot, a restaurant and cocktail hang out which specializes in sushi, tacos, and mescal, replicating the successful formula of the original Coffee Pot in San Lorenzo. Come for a pre-dinner buffet and drink, stay for the a la carte menu which includes a sushi taco and bento boxes, or drop in later for imaginative cocktails. (craft beer, wine, cocktails)

10. Ai Tre Scalini

Via Panisperna 251, Tel +39 +39 0648907495

This extremely popular wine bar in hip Monti is packed with locals all year round, plus a fair share of tourists that manage to squeeze into its atmospheric interior. Friendly staff, excellent wine by the glass, and surprisingly good bar food are just some of the hallmarks of this institution in Via Panisperna. The craft beers include gluten-free options and they also have a good range of long drinks but don’t expect cocktails. In terms of food, they’re best at cold-cuts and cheese boards, pack mean porchetta, and the buffalo mozzarella will leave you licking your lips. Perch at the bar if tables aren’t available – you can still eat and it’s actually more fun. This bar is open virtually all year round and is a great spot for some wifi business and a glass of wine in the afternoons. (long drinks, aperitifs, wine, beer)
